Located just steps from Northport Harbor, Shipwreck Diner brings together maritime charm and timeless diner classics in one cozy, family-friendly spot. With its porthole windows, ship-themed décor, and welcoming vibe, this Northport staple offers comfort food and personality in equal measure.
The breakfast menu is a highlight, with crowd-pleasers like Belgian waffles, steak and eggs, and custom omelets made to order. For lunch or dinner, diners enjoy staples like turkey clubs, tuna melts, meatloaf, and fish and chips. The portions are generous, the flavors are homey, and the service is consistently warm and fast.
Seafood options include fried clam strips and classic New England-style fish dishes, often served with fries and coleslaw. Diners rave about the cornbread and pies, particularly the warm apple pie and house-made desserts. Milkshakes and old-fashioned root beer floats round out the nostalgic diner experience.
The atmosphere is casual and welcoming, with chrome-trimmed booths, checkerboard floors, and nautical details that make the space unique without feeling like a gimmick. It's a great spot for early breakfasts, midday pit stops, or a quiet evening bite with family. The location and hours make it ideal for a stroll through the village before or after your meal.
